Eventi e aggiornamenti dell'ecosistema
1) Attività sezione e bordi
Gli eventi e gli aggiornamenti dell'ecosistema sono un modo standardizzato per annunciare, distribuire e confermare le modifiche (prodotto, contenuti, pagamenti/ARM, KYC/AML, marketing, infrastrutture, regole e metriche) per tutti i ruoli della rete: operatori, studi/RGS, aggregatori, affiliati/media, PSP/APM, KYS Provider e strimer C/AML.
Obiettivi: prevedibilità dei comunicati, riduzione delle controversie, controllo dei rischi, prova dei dati e un'unica comprensione dello status di cosa/quando/perché è cambiato.
2) Ontologia degli eventi (canonica)
Сущности: `eventId`, `type`, `scope`, `version`, `status`, `window`, `owner`, `traceId`, `breakingChange`, `rollbackPlanId`.
Tipi ('type'):- `product_release`, `content_update`, `rgs_update`, `payment_route_change`, `kyc_policy_change`,
- `marketing_campaign`, `rg_policy_update`, `jurisdiction_notice`,
- `infra_maintenance`, `security_bulletin`, `data_formula_change` (формулы GGR/NetRev/CR и др.).
- Статусы (`status`): `planned` → `staged` → `rolling_out` → `live` → `paused/rolled_back` → `closed`.
- Окна (`window`): `green` (low-risk), `yellow` (controlled), `red` (change-freeze).
- Tutti gli schemi di eventi sono a Schema Registry, i tempi sono UTC/ISO-8601, le somme sono a «currency».
3) Versioning e tipi di modifiche
«MAGGIORE». MINOR. PATCH (MAJOR - breaking - Principi di attribuzione, formule metriche; MINOR - nuovi campi/fili PATCH - Correzioni).
Data Contracts - La versione dello schema evento e quella della formula metrica vengono sempre pubblicate insieme.
Migration Note: campi obbligatori come migrare, data di accesso, finestra di interoperabilità.
Frozen-period: periodo minimo di stabilità dopo MAJOR (ad esempio, 14 giorni).
4) Calendario delle release e priorità
Livello annuale - cardini chiave (modifiche regolatorie, stagioni di picco).
Livello trimestrale: grandi iniziative MAJOR/intercorrenti.
Strato settimanale: MINOR/PATCH, marketing/contenuti, pagamenti/CUS.
Priorità: sicurezza/compilazione> pagamenti/CUS> stabilità RGS/contenuti> marketing.
Conflitti: conflitto-assegno automatico geo/fuso orario/picchi di traffico.
5) Protocollo di pubblicazione dell'aggiornamento
1. Announcement Draft (owner): descrizione degli obiettivi/benefici, impatto su KPI, scope (catene/geo/marchi), valutazione dei rischi.
2. Spec & Contracts: schemi/formule aggiornati, valigette di prova, migrazioni.
3. Approval Gate: Legal/Privacy/RG/Security/Finance/Protocol Council.
4. Staging: scarico di sabbia + conformazioni-test, carico di lavoro e test di caos.
5. Progressive Delivery: 1% → 5% → 25% → 50% → 100% с guardrails (см. §7).
6. Go/No-Go - Assegno-fogli, war-room abilitata, stop-pulsanti pronti.
7. Changelog & Rollout Note: scrittura dettagliata nel registro delle modifiche + note pubbliche.
8. Post-Release Review: telemetria, deviazioni RCA, bacap/pulizia flag.
6) Trasporto eventi (API/webhook/EDA)
API (REST/gRPC): '/ vN/events ', puntatori,' Idempotency-Key ', errori di macchina, paginazione solo di cursore.
Web Hookie: JWS/HMAC firma, «kid», «timestamp», «traceId», backoff esponenziale + jitter, registro di riscossione.
EDA (pneumatico): partizionamento per «eventId »/« traceId», exactly-once per senso aziendale (idampotenza dei consumatori).
Tracing: W3C traceparent, dall'evento alle metriche e alle fatture reali.
7) Guardrail, SLO e pulsanti di stop
SLO operativi (punti di riferimento):- Consegna dei webhoot al 99. 9%, p95 ≤ 1-2 secondi.
- API p95 ≤ 150–300 мс, error rate ≤ 0,3–0,5%.
- p95, 200-500 mc, consegna 99,9%.
- Le vetrine sono fresche di 1-5 c, p95 render da 1,5-2,0 s.
- CR pagamenti nella coorte - X% su qualsiasi livello di espansione.
- Trigger RG/1k attivi nel corridoio di destinazione.
- fuori dal corridoio per un'auto-pausa.
- I pulsanti di arresto sono: «traffic _ route», «offer», «content _ build», «apm _ route», «rgs _ flag», «data _ formula».
8) A/B e inclusioni progressive
L'esperimento è un evento con versione e obiettivi.
Dislocazione di gradini (1→5→25→50→100%) con controlli automatici di guardia su ogni gradino.
Obbligatorio «experimentId», «bucket» e collegamento con KPI/Scorecards.
I risultati e la soluzione (promote/rollback) sono pubblicati su changelog.
9) Changelog, Roadmap e notifiche
Changelog (WORM) - Registro invariato per tutti gli eventi con diagrammi/formule e firme.
Roadmap: статусы `Planned/In-Progress/Rolling Out/Live/Not-Now`.
I messaggi di ruolo: operatore/studio/affiliato/PSP/KYC/flag ricevono notifiche appropriate per geo/marchio/catena.
Note pubbliche: brevi note di rilascio per partner/comunità esterne (senza PDN/parti segrete).
10) Oracoli di dati e provabilità
Dashboard firmati per gli aggiornamenti chiave: impatto sull' GGR/NetRev/CR/RG/SLO.
Ogni riepilogo è «formulaVersion», «hash», «traceId», «kid», il periodo della finestra.
Utilizzo: fattura, sanzioni/bonus, appello, RCA.
11) Dashboard e panoramica operativa
La barra di rilascio (real-time) è un elenco di eventi attivi, una fase di espansione, trasporto SLO, corridoi aziendali, bandiere RG/SEC.
L'effetto degli aggiornamenti è il ΔCR/FTD/ARPU/LTV/NetRev di coorte/mercato/catena.
Stabilità delle formule: monitoraggio delle differenze tra le versioni di formula e il fatto (alert).
SLA Pack Trace: 60-90 s a P1/P2 incidente.
12) Sicurezza, privacy, compliance
Zero Trust: mTLS, token a vita corta, egress-allow-list, rotazione chiavi/JWKS.
Riduzioni PII: token invece di PDN; La detonazione è solo nella cassaforte.
ABAC/ReBAC/SoD «Vedo solo ciò che è mio e concordato»; la divisione dei ruoli «misuro l'influenza ».
DPIA/DPA per gli eventi che interessano PDN/localizzazione/righe di memorizzazione.
Notices Giurisdiction: rilascia automaticamente le notifiche in caso di interruzione delle regole di mercato.
13) Incidenti, war-room e RCA
Matrice P1/P2 e playbook finiti per tipo di evento.
War-room - Chat/anello della chiamata, stati del sistema, assegni di accensione/rimborso, gestori responsabili.
RCA senza ricerca di colpevoli: fatti/processi; pubblicazione di conclusioni e attività in backlog.
Post-mortem SLO: tempo fino alla pausa, al rientro, alla stabilizzazione, alla pubblicazione delle note.
14) RACI (esempio)
15) Anti-pattern
«Due verità» per metriche/formule e date di ingresso.
Paginazione offset della cronologia sotto carico (solo cursori).
Lo zoo postbeek e le webhoot non firmate, le riprese/buchi/discussioni.
Rilasci segreti senza changelog/roadmap e notifiche.
SLO «su carta» senza alert o pulsanti di stop automatici.
Esporta il PDN nelle note di rilascio/dashboard.
Le eccezioni senza TTL/controllo sono override-a.
Nessun piano di ripristino e rehearsals DR/xaoc.
16) Assegno fogli
Progettazione
- Ontologia degli eventi, Schema Registry, versioni delle formule.
- Release Calendar: finestre verdi/gialle/rosse sui mercati/catene.
- Guardrails и SLO; pulsanti di arresto e script playout.
- Formato Data Contracts/Oracle Controllo WORM.
- Criteri di notifica e ruoli di distribuzione.
- DPIA/DPA per gli eventi con PDN.
Avvia
- Sabbia, conformazione, carico di lavoro e test di caos.
- Schizzo progressivo del 1→5→25→50→100% con logica di pausa automatica.
- War room è pronta, i ruoli di guardia sono assegnati.
- Changelog/Release Note sono in anticipo, etichette in dashboard.
Utilizzo
- Panoramica settimanale degli eventi e degli effetti di Roadmap.
- Chainjlog mensili di formule/diagrammi e ruvidità di guardia.
- Regolari DR/xaoc-esercitazioni gateway, pneumatici, vetrine e Tesoro.
17) Road map della maturità
v1 (Fondazione) - ontologia di base degli eventi, calendario, changelog, Go/No-Go manuali e rimborsi.
v2 (Integration) - Rilasci progressivi, scorie automatiche e pulsanti di arresto, oracoli di dati, notifiche di ruolo.
v3 (Automation) - Finestre di mappatura predittive, suggerimenti di rischio ML, effetti smart-riconciliazione, generazione automatica delle note.
v4 (Networked Governance) - Sincronizzazione federale degli eventi tra catene, oracoli intercorrenti, regole DAO delle formule e trasparenti del Tesoro.
18) Metriche di successo
Velocità/prevedibilità: percentuale di rilascio nella finestra programmata, tempo medio da «planned» a «live».
Qualità/rischio: MTTR rilascio-incidenti, percentuale di pausa/rientro auto, controvalore <X%.
Effetto business: uplift/stabilità per eventi.
Compilazione/RG: 0 fuoriuscite di PDN, corrispondenza DPIA/DPA, trigger RG nel corridoio.
Trasparenza: completezza changelog, tempo di pubblicazione Release Note, SLA «pacchetto trace».
Breve riepilogo
Gli eventi e gli aggiornamenti dell'ecosistema non sono solo un calendario di release, ma un protocollo di fiducia: un'unica ontologia e versioni, una progressiva inclusione con le guardie automatiche, dati provabili (oracoli), changelog/roadmap trasparenti e disciplina degli incidenti. Questa struttura rende i cambiamenti prevedibili, sicuri e misurabili e accelera la crescita dell'intera rete.